David H. Murdock Jr. the 90 year old self made billionaire and chief executive of Dole Food Company Inc (NYSE: DOLE) has agreed to buy and take full control of the company for $1.6 billion. He already own 40% of the company's share and is paying $13.50 a share for the rest of the 60%, $1.50 higher then his original offer of $12 a share. The board has unanimously agreed to this decision, however they still have 30 days period where if a better offer comes this deal would be voided.
